Getting There

  • Walking

    If you are in Downtown Spokane, head towards Riverside Avenue. Look for the intersection with Howard Street. Once you reach Riverside Avenue, turn west and walk for about 5 minutes. You will find Jackalope Axe Throwing at 226 W Riverside Ave, right next to the Spokane River.

  • Public Transport - Bus

    Find the nearest Spokane Transit Authority bus stop. Take the bus number 25 or 26 towards Downtown Spokane. Get off at the 'Main & Howard' stop. From there, walk west on Main Avenue for two blocks until you reach Riverside Avenue. Turn left on Riverside Avenue and walk for about 2 minutes to reach Jackalope Axe Throwing at 226 W Riverside Ave.

  • Biking

    If you prefer biking, rent a bike from a local bike-sharing service in Spokane. Head towards Riverside Avenue by following the bike lanes through Downtown Spokane. Once you reach Riverside Avenue, continue west for about 5 minutes. Jackalope Axe Throwing will be on your right at 226 W Riverside Ave.

Discover more about Jackalope Axe Throwing Spokane

Jackalope Axe Throwing Spokane is the perfect destination for tourists looking to add a bit of thrill to their visit. Nestled in the vibrant downtown area, this unique event venue specializes in axe throwing, offering an exhilarating experience for groups of all sizes. Whether you're planning a night out with friends, a family gathering, or a memorable corporate event, Jackalope provides a lively atmosphere that encourages friendly competition and camaraderie. The venue is designed to accommodate both novice throwers and seasoned pros, ensuring that everyone can participate and have a blast. Upon entering, you'll be greeted by enthusiastic staff ready to guide you through the basics of axe throwing. They prioritize safety while making sure you have fun, providing tips and tricks to improve your technique. The venue features multiple throwing lanes, each equipped with everything needed for a successful throwing session. To enhance your experience, Jackalope also offers a variety of beverages to keep you refreshed as you enjoy the thrill of the throw.
